WebRights of way for multiple transmission lines are generally wider. 500kV lines commonly use a 175 or 200-foot right of way. 230kV lines commonly use a 150-foot right of way. 230kV lines commonly use a 150-foot right of way. 161kV single- or double-circuit lines commonly use a 100 or 150-foot right of way. WebMay 1, 2024 · Right of Way: The most common type of easement, it provides for access to the dominant estate over the servient estate. Utility: Allows for wires, cable, or pipes to be strung over, placed upon, or buried under the servient estate.
